Improving JavaScript Bundle Performance With Code-Splitting

Smashing Magazine

Improving JavaScript Bundle Performance With Code-Splitting. Improving JavaScript Bundle Performance With Code-Splitting. Projects built using JavaScript-based frameworks often ship large bundles of JavaScript that take time to download, parse and execute, blocking page render and user input in the process. What is web application security? Everything you need to know.

Dynatrace

In this blog, I’ll first cover the basics, explaining what web application security is and why it’s important. Web application security is the process of protecting web applications against various types of threats that are designed to exploit vulnerabilities in an application’s code. Dynatrace news.

Detecting Speech and Music in Audio Content

The Netflix TechBlog

In this blog post, we will introduce speech and music detection as an enabling technology for a variety of audio applications in Film & TV, as well as introduce our speech and music activity detection (SMAD) system which we recently published as a journal article in EURASIP Journal on Audio, Speech, and Music Processing.
